Latest Patents

One of his latest patents is for an electronic device that includes a conductive fixing member. This invention describes a housing that contains a coaxial cable and a fixing member made of conductive material. The fixing member is designed to electrically connect the coaxial cable and a flexible printed circuit board with the housing. This innovation aims to improve the integration of electronic components within devices.

Another notable patent involves an electronic device for performing carrier aggregation using multiple carrier frequencies. This invention outlines a method for determining the number of frequency bands used in communication circuits. It includes a switching operation controlled by specific conditions, allowing for efficient processing of carrier signals across different frequency bands.
